How Torpen T 4000mg/500mg Injection works:

The injectable formulation Torpen T (4000mg/500mg) unites piperacillin, a crucial antibiotic, with tazobactam, a beta-lactamase inhibitor. Piperacillin's mechanism involves disrupting bacterial cell wall synthesis, a vital process for bacterial viability. Tazobactam's role is to counteract bacterial resistance mechanisms, thereby augmenting piperacillin's antibacterial efficacy.

SAFETY ADVICE

AlcoholAlcoholSAFE

There are no known adverse reactions associated with the concomitant use of alcohol and Torpen T 4000mg/500mg Injection.

PregnancyPregnancySAFE IF PRESCRIBED

Administration of Torpen T 4000mg/500mg Injection is typically deemed safe for pregnant individuals. Preclinical trials using animal models revealed minimal or absent harm to offspring; nevertheless, clinical data from human studies remain scarce.

Breast feedingBreast feedingSAFE IF PRESCRIBED

Torpen T 4000mg/500mg Injection poses minimal risk during lactation. Research in humans indicates negligible transfer of the medication into breast milk, posing no discernible harm to the infant.

DrivingDrivingC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

The impact of Torpen T 4000mg/500mg Injection on driving ability is undetermined. Refrain from driving if you experience symptoms impairing concentration or reaction time.

KidneyKidneyCAUTION

Patients with kidney impairment should use Torpen T 4000mg/500mg Injection cautiously, potentially requiring dosage modification. Physician consultation is recommended.

LiverLiverSAFE IF PRESCRIBED

The use of Torpen T 4000mg/500mg Injection in patients with hepatic impairment appears to pose minimal risk. Preliminary evidence indicates that dosage modification for this patient group may be unnecessary. However, physician consultation is recommended.

FAQs on Torpen T 4000mg/500mg Injection

Torpen T 4000mg/500mg Injection combats bacterial infections. This dual-medicine formulation treats various infections, including those of the tonsils, sinuses, middle ear, respiratory and urinary tracts, as well as boils, abscesses, cellulitis, wounds, bones, and the oral cavity.
Torpen T 4000mg/500mg Injection is safe when used as directed by your doctor. Some patients may experience side effects such as diarrhea, nausea, vomiting, rash, or allergic reactions. Report any persistent issues to your doctor immediately.
Torpen T 4000mg/500mg Injection must be administered only by a healthcare professional. Dosage is determined by your doctor based on your condition. Strictly adhere to your doctor's instructions for optimal results.
Torpen T 4000mg/500mg Injection is unsafe for individuals allergic to penicillin or any of its components, and should be avoided by those with liver disease. Always consult your doctor before using this injection.
Torpen T 4000mg/500mg Injection may reduce the effectiveness of birth control pills. Discuss alternative contraceptive methods, such as condoms, diaphragms, or spermicides, with your doctor while using this injection.
Use Torpen T 4000mg/500mg Injection only as directed. Exceeding the recommended dose increases the risk of side effects. Treatment may take time; be patient. Contact your doctor if symptoms worsen.
Store this medication in its original, tightly closed container, following the storage instructions on the label. Discard any unused medication and ensure it's inaccessible to children, pets, and others.
Torpen T 4000mg/500mg Injection may trigger allergic reactions and is contraindicated for individuals with penicillin allergies. Seek immediate medical attention if you experience symptoms such as hives, breathing difficulties, or swelling of the face, lips, tongue, or throat.
Torpen T 4000mg/500mg Injection may cause diarrhea as a side effect. This is because, while it eliminates harmful bacteria, it can also affect beneficial gut bacteria. If diarrhea occurs, increase your fluid intake. However, if diarrhea persists or you experience dehydration symptoms such as infrequent, dark, strong-smelling urine, consult your doctor immediately.
